Original Description
Step into the warm glow of Herman Frederik Carel ten Kate's Maler In Einer Wirtsstube (Painter in a Tavern), where golden lamplight washes over a cozy 19th-century Dutch tavern scene. Painted around 1850-1860, this masterpiece exemplifies the Romantic movement's fascination with humble, intimate moments. Ten Kate, a Dutch genre painter trained at the Royal Academy of Art in The Hague, excelled in capturing bourgeois interiors with remarkable atmospheric precision. The composition draws viewers into the painter's world – his concentrated expression, the rustic wooden table, and the attentive patrons all frozen in a moment of creative alchemy. Historically significant as part of Northern Europe's Biedermeier-influenced genre painting revival, the work bridges Rembrandt's chiaroscuro tradition with emerging realist tendencies, offering invaluable insight into Dutch artistic circles during this transitional period.
